New drug combo offers hope for Hard-to-Treat blood cancer

NCT ID NCT06712121

First seen Feb 02, 2026 · Last updated May 20, 2026 · Updated 14 times

Summary

This study tests whether a combination of two drugs, venetoclax and decitabine, can help adults with T-cell acute lymphoblastic leukemia or lymphoma that has come back or not responded to standard treatment. About 28 participants aged 19 to 79 will receive this modified chemotherapy regimen. The goal is to see if the treatment can achieve complete remission or significant blood cell recovery.
